Observability
Drop telemetry into the backend you already use
OrchVynt emits structured telemetry in OpenTelemetry format — compatible with every major observability backend. Prometheus scrape endpoint included for metrics-first teams.
Datadog
Via OTLP export or Datadog Agent receiver
Grafana / Loki
Pre-built dashboard, Prometheus + Loki shipping
Honeycomb
Native OTLP traces with span-level routing metadata
New Relic
OTLP traces and Prometheus metrics
Jaeger
Distributed tracing for multi-agent spans
Prometheus
Scrape /metrics endpoint. Key metrics: invocation rate, routing decisions, fallback activations, budget utilization
Notifications & HITL
Deliver HITL alerts to your existing approval channels
Slack
Post HITL gate open notifications to a channel. Approve/reject from Slack via interactive message
Webhook
POST to any webhook endpoint on HITL open, budget breach, or fallback activation events
PagerDuty
Trigger incidents on critical threshold breaches or HITL timeout events
